Owner-Mr. Samoraphouma Khoumphetsavong

Mr Samoraphouma is a new age, Lao entrepreneur with a strong interest in the hotel business and a years of experience of owning and operating guest houses in Luang Prabang.

After studying Business Management in Germany for 7 years, and working in the construction industry doing accounting and cost control, Mr Samoraphouma returned to Laos in 1996 and started a company called "Lao-German Co. Ltd".  But with his prime interests in the tourism industry, especially in Luang Prabang, Mr Samoraphouma Khoumphetsa opened three guest houses; Merry 1, Merry 2 and Merry 3. With success in these and a constant demand for quality accommodation in Luang Prabang, he later opened Villa Merry Lao-Swiss in 2005.

This extensive experience both domestically and abroad has seen Mr Samoraphouma reach high standards. Each guest house offers you high quality service, facilities, ambiance and hospitality.

Detailed description of the Caring for the Destination Initiative:

In partnership with Villa Merry Lao Swiss, Villa Merry No 1 has been working with several schools over the last 3-4 years to help improve the learning conditions and educational support available to young Lao students from villages outside of Luang Prabang city. 

Currently they are trying to raise USD7, 000 to pay for the refurbishment of an old school in Kialuang Village.  This school was originally constructed by the US Embassy in 1974 but has since fallen into disrepair.  Funds generated will allow for the replacement of the roof, windows, doors and a new coat of paint for the building.  So far USD1500 has been raised.  If you would like to help please speak to Mr Samor at the guesthouse.
